K-5 Assemblies
North Pointe Ballet’s K-5 Assemblies consist of performance excerpts of full-length ballets by fully-costumed professional dancers, as well as movement activities to engage students in active learning led by NPB dancers and directors.
In North Pointe Ballet’s effort to make classical ballet accessible to everyone, NPB’s school assemblies engage students in a theatrical production differently than a traditional theater experience and offer them a chance to experience ballet up-close and learn what it means to be a professional dancer. Each tour offers a unique focus, including pantomime, storytelling, character development, and healthy lifestyles.
Each program is 45-55 minutes in length and can be customized to accommodate schedule and audience needs. Cost for the program is $500. Discounts available for schools and facilities that qualify.

Peter Pan Field Trip
North Pointe Ballet makes classical ballet accessible to everyone by providing this field trip opportunity annually at a low cost to students. NPB’s Peter Pan is a retelling of the beloved story brought to life through professional ballet dancers, live-narration, and special theatrical effects, including flying effects. Teachers are provided with downloadable classroom resources. Students will have the opportunity for a Q and A session with the cast and crew to learn about the “magic” created during the performance and what it is like to put on a full-scale professional ballet production.
